Deputies Suspect Fireworks Caused Brush Fire In Canyon Country

Deputies with the Santa Clarita Valley Sheriff’s Station are investigating whether or not fireworks launched by juveniles caused a ½ acre brush fire off Marilyn Drive.

“We’re still looking to determine whether it is accurate,” said Sheriff’s Lt. Leo Bauer, regarding the alleged firework firing.

The blaze burned about ½ an acre, according to officials with Los Angeles County Fire. Firefighters received reports of the fire around 7:17 p.m., and stopped all forward progress by 7:35 p.m.

Sheriff’s deputies have reason to believe two male juveniles were involved, and are actively working to investigate the information.

No structures were damaged, and no injuries were reported.

This is the third brush fire firefighters responded to within two days, the past two being the Pitchess Fire near Pitchess Detention Center in Castaic, and the Arline Fire near residences in Canyon Country.
